6 大核心概念
1. Workflow(工作流)
# .github/workflows/ci.yml
name: CI
on:
push:
branches: [main]
pull_request:
branches: [main]
jobs:
test: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
with:
node-version: 20
- run: npm ci
- run: npm test
2. Event(事件)
on:
push: # 推送
pull_request: # PR
schedule: # 定时
- cron: '0 0 * * *' # 每天凌晨
workflow_dispatch: # 手动触发
release: # 发布
types: [published]
issues: # Issue
types: [opened]
3. Job(任务)
jobs:
test:
runs-on: ubuntu-latest
steps: [...]
deploy:
needs: test # 依赖
runs-on: ubuntu-latest
if: github.ref == 'refs/heads/main' # 条件
steps: [...]
4. Step(步骤)
steps:
- name: Checkout
uses: actions/checkout@v4
- name: Setup Node
uses: actions/setup-node@v4
with:
node-version: 20
- name: Install
run: npm ci
- name: Test
run: npm test
env:
API_KEY: ${{ secrets.API_KEY }}
5. Runner(运行环境)
runs-on: ubuntu-latest # Linux
# runs-on: macos-latest # macOS
# runs-on: windows-latest # Windows
# runs-on: ubuntu-22.04-arm # ARM
6. Action(操作)
# 官方
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
# 社区
- uses: actions/setup-pnpm@v4
- uses: arduino/setup-task@v2
# 自定义
- uses: ./my-action # 本地 action
8 个实战 Workflow
Workflow 1:基础 CI(Node.js)
# .github/workflows/ci.yml
name: CI
on:
push:
branches: [main]
pull_request:
branches: [main]
jobs:
test: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
with:
node-version: 20
cache: 'npm'
- name: Install
run: npm ci
- name: TypeScript
run: npx tsc --noEmit
- name: Lint
run: npm run lint
- name: Test
run: npm test
env:
DATABASE_URL: postgresql://test:test@localhost:5432/test
- name: Build
run: npm run build
- name: Upload artifact
uses: actions/upload-artifact@v4
with:
name: build
path: dist/
Workflow 2:多 Node 版本测试
name: Multi-Node Test
on: [push, pull_request]
jobs:
test:
runs-on: ubuntu-latest
strategy:
matrix:
node-version: [18, 20, 22]
steps:
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
with:
node-version: ${{ matrix.node-version }}
- run: npm ci
- run: npm test
Workflow 3:自动部署到 Vercel(与 7/18 关联)
name: Deploy
on:
push:
branches: [main]
jobs:
deploy: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
with:
node-version: 20
- name: Install Vercel CLI
run: npm install -g vercel
- name: Pull Vercel config
run: vercel pull --yes --environment=production --token=${{ secrets.VERCEL_TOKEN }}
- name: Build
run: vercel build --prod --token=${{ secrets.VERCEL_TOKEN }}
- name: Deploy
run: vercel deploy --prebuilt --prod --token=${{ secrets.VERCEL_TOKEN }}
Workflow 4:Docker 镜像构建推送(与 7/19 关联)
name: Docker Build & Push
on:
push:
branches: [main]
tags: ['v*']
jobs:
docker: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
- name: Login to Docker Hub
uses: docker/login-action@v3
with:
username: ${{ secrets.DOCKER_USERNAME }}
password: ${{ secrets.DOCKER_TOKEN }}
- name: Build and push
uses: docker/build-push-action@v5
with:
context: .
push: true
tags: |
myuser/myapp:latest
myuser/myapp:${{ github.sha }}
cache-from: type=gha
cache-to: type=gha,mode=max
Workflow 5:E2E 测试(Playwright)
name: E2E Test
on:
push:
branches: [main]
jobs:
e2e: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
- uses: actions/setup-node@v4
with:
node-version: 20
- name: Install
run: npm ci
- name: Install Playwright
run: npx playwright install --with-deps
- name: Build
run: npm run build
- name: Start server
run: |
npm start &
sleep 10
- name: Run tests
run: npx playwright test
- name: Upload report
if: always()
uses: actions/upload-artifact@v4
with:
name: playwright-report
path: playwright-report/
Workflow 6:安全扫描
name: Security
on:
push:
branches: [main]
pull_request:
schedule:
- cron: '0 0 * * 1' # 每周一
jobs:
security: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v4
# 依赖漏洞扫描
- name: npm audit
run: npm audit --audit-level=moderate
# CodeQL 扫描
- name: Initialize CodeQL
uses: github/codeql-action/init@v3
with:
languages: javascript
- name: Perform CodeQL Analysis
uses: github/codeql-action/analyze@v3
# Secret 扫描
- name: TruffleHog
uses: trufflesecurity/trufflehog@main
with:
args: --directory=. --json
# SAST
- name: Semgrep
uses: returntocorp/semgrep-action@v1

5 个常用 Action
1. pnpm 安装
- uses: pnpm/action-setup@v4
with:
version: 9
2. 缓存依赖
- uses: actions/cache@v4
with:
path: ~/.npm
key: ${{ runner.os }}-node-${{ hashFiles('**/package-lock.json') }}
3. 上传 / 下载 Artifact
- uses: actions/upload-artifact@v4
with:
name: build
path: dist/
- uses: actions/download-artifact@v4
with:
name: build
path: dist/
4. 设置环境变量
- name: Set env
run: echo "VERSION=1.0.0" >> $GITHUB_ENV
5. SSH 部署
- name: Deploy via SSH
uses: appleboy/ssh-action@v1
with:
host: ${{ secrets.HOST }}
username: ${{ secrets.USERNAME }}
key: ${{ secrets.SSH_KEY }}
script: |
cd /app
git pull
npm ci
npm run build
pm2 restart app
5 个常见坑
坑 1:超时
默认超时 6 小时
免费 runner 内存 7GB
❌ 大型 build 卡死
✅ 拆分 job / 用缓存 / 用自托管 runner
坑 2:免费额度
免费:2000 分钟/月(Linux)
macOS / Windows:10x 计算(更贵)
❌ 大项目频繁跑 CI
✅ 缓存依赖 + 减少触发条件
坑 3:Secret 泄露
# ❌ 错误
echo "API_KEY=$API_KEY" >> $GITHUB_ENV
# ✅ 正确(仅本 step 可见)
env:
API_KEY: ${{ secrets.API_KEY }}
坑 4:并发问题
# ❌ 多个 PR 同时部署会冲突
on: pull_request
# ✅ 串行部署
concurrency:
group: ${{ github.workflow }}-${{ github.ref }}
cancel-in-progress: false
坑 5:依赖缓存失效
# ✅ 正确缓存 key
- uses: actions/setup-node@v4
with:
cache: 'npm' # 自动用 package-lock.json 作 key
